Embedded microcontrollers play an essential role in applications such as industrial control, medical device operation, and home automation. The microcontroller of choice in these applications is often the Z8F2402VS020EC00TR. This device provides the user with advanced sensing, microprocessor, and programmable logic capabilities. Here we will discuss the application field and working principle of the Z8F2402VS020EC00TR.
Application Field
The Z8F2402VS020EC00TR is suitable for a number of applications. This microcontroller integrates an extensive set of peripherals, making it possible to construct a compact and cost effective system. These peripherals include on-chip I/O, A/D converters, and pulse-width modulators. This microcontroller can be used in a variety of applications such as motor control, energy management/metering, home automation and industrial process monitoring/control. In motor control applications, the Z8F2402VS020EC00TR can be used to control the speed and torque of a motor by monitoring speed and load feedback signals. In energy management/metering applications, the device can be used to monitor the power and current consumption of a system and report the values to an external device for control. In home automation applications, the microcontroller can be used to automate household appliances such as lights, security systems, and temperature control. Finally, in industrial process monitoring/control applications, the Z8F2402VS020EC00TR can be used to monitor and control a variety of manufacturing processes.
Working Principle
The Z8F2402VS020EC00TR is based on an 8-bit Z8 core running at up to 40 MHz, giving it processing capability of up to 8 MIPS. It features a wide variety of peripherals including two analouge comparators, a high resolution 10 bit ADC, two general purpose timer/PWM units, a SPI interface, an I2C interface, and two serial UART ports. In addition, the microcontroller has internal program and data memories, allowing it to operate autonomously. Internal memory options include 8Kbytes of ROM and 1Kbytes of RAM.
In operation, the Z8F2402VS020EC00TR is controlled by instructions stored within the ROM. These instructions are written in a low level assembly language and are used to manipulate the state of the microcontroller\'s registers. These instructions are fetched from memory and decoded by the microcontroller\'s CPU. The CPU then execuets the instructions which cause the microcontroller to perfom various tasks such as reading and writing data, controlling peripherals, and comparing data values.
The microcontroller has a number of pins which it uses to communicate with the outside world. These pins can be configured as input or output pins, allowing the Z8F2402VS020EC00TR to read and write data. These pins are connected to a variety of external devices, such as switches, sensors, and motors, allowing the microcontroller to interact with these devices. On the Z8F2402VS020EC00TR, these pins are labeled as P0-P5, allowing the user to easily identify them.
The Z8F2402VS020EC00TR also has several special-function registers which are used to control the operation of the device. These special function registers can be used to configure the operation of the microcontroller and its peripherals. For instance, the interrupt control register can be used to configure how the CPU responds to external interrupts, and the power control register can be used to configure how the microcontroller handles low power states.
In summary, the Z8F2402VS020EC00TR is a versatile embedded microcontroller used in a variety of industrial, medical, and home automation applications. It features a high performance Z8 core, an extensive set of peripherals, and a wide array of input and output pins. This allows users to construct a compact, low power, and cost effective system. The device can be configured by setting its special-function registers to enable the various features and configure the device for the desired application.
